Target Background

Function(From Uniprot)
Functions as a RAC1 guanine nucleotide exchange factor (GEF), activating Rac proteins by exchanging bound GDP for free GTP. Its activity is synergistically activated by phosphatidylinositol 3,4,5-trisphosphate and the beta gamma subunits of heterotrimeric G protein. Mediates the activation of RAC1 in a PI3K-dependent manner. May be an important mediator of Rac signaling, acting directly downstream of both G protein-coupled receptors and phosphoinositide 3-kinase.
Gene References into Functions
  1. complex signaling mechanisms that involve PREX2, PI3K/AKT/PTEN and downstream epigenetic machinery to deregulate expression of key cell cycle regulators PMID:27111337
  2. P-REX2 PH-domain-mediated inhibition of PTEN has a role in regulating insulin sensitivity and glucose homeostasis PMID:24367090
  3. This study demonistrated that the P-Rex2, a GEF that specifically activates Rac small GTPases, is expressed in a cell- and synapse-specific manner in the retina. PMID:23844743
  4. PI3K/P-Rex/Rac pathway is required for late phase long-term potentiation in the mouse cerebellum PMID:20694145
  5. P-Rex1 and P-Rex2 are important regulators of Purkinje cell morphology and cerebellar function PMID:18334636
